How much do spa reception j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 9, 2026, the average hourly pay for spa reception in the United States is $17.82,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$15.14 and $19.95 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a spa receptionist do?

A Spa Receptionist is responsible for greeting clients, managing appointments, and providing information about spa services. They handle phone calls, check-in and check-out guests, and process payments. Additionally, they help maintain a calm and welcoming environment, assist with administrative tasks, and ensure clients have a positive experience from arrival to departure.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a spa receptionist,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Spa Receptionist, you need strong customer service skills, organizational abilities, and basic computer literacy, often supported by a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with booking software, point-of-sale (POS) systems, and phone systems is typically required. Exceptional communication, professionalism, and the ability to multitask help create a welcoming atmosphere and efficiently handle client needs. These skills ensure smooth spa operations, high client satisfaction, and effective management of appointments and inquiries.

What are some common challenges faced by spa receptionists, and how can they be managed effectively?

Spa receptionists often face challenges such as managing multiple client bookings, handling last-minute schedule changes, and balancing front desk duties with providing excellent customer service. Staying organized with digital booking systems and maintaining clear communication with both clients and therapists helps ensure a smooth workflow. Developing strong multitasking and conflict-resolution skills also enables spa receptionists to efficiently handle busy periods and resolve any client concerns in a professional manner.

While Spa Receptionists handle guest check-ins, bookings, and customer service, Spa Therapists focus on providing treatments like massages and facials. Both roles are essential in a spa setting but differ in responsibilities, skills, and certifications.

How to get a job as a spa receptionist?

To become a spa receptionist, candidates typically need a high school diploma or equivalent and strong customer service skills. Previous experience in hospitality or administrative roles can be beneficial, and familiarity with booking software or point-of-sale systems is often preferred. Good communication, organization, and a professional appearance are important for success in this role.

Is being a spa reception at a spa hard?

Being a spa receptionist involves managing customer check-ins, scheduling appointments, and providing excellent customer service, which requires good communication and organizational skills. The job can be physically demanding due to long hours on your feet and handling multiple tasks simultaneously, but it generally does not require specialized technical skills. The difficulty level varies depending on the spa's size and customer volume.

What You'll Do
  • Maintain a positive and professional approach with employees, coworkers and guests.
  • Communicate regularly with spa staff regarding appointments and required timeframes to ensure smooth workflow throughout the day.
  • Greet clients warmly as they enter the spa and provide tours and information related to spa features and services.
  • Answer the telephone professionally by identifying yourself, your department and offering assistance.
  • Book appointments by phone or in person and accurately record transactions in the reservation system.
  • Promote spa services and effectively recommend retail products to enhance the guest experience.
  • Maintain proper opening and closing procedures and handle transactions responsibly and accurately.
  • Follow daily checklists and operational procedures as outlined for spa reception and attendant duties.
  • Maintain a well-groomed, professional appearance including clean uniform and name tag.
  • Follow all safety and health regulations including Personal Protective Equipment (PPE) protocol policies.
  • Maintain spa rooms, public areas and front-of-house spaces in a clean, comfortable and guest-ready condition, including refreshing water, ice and trash removal.
  • Support inventory control for supplies, equipment and merchandise and communicate reordering needs as necessary.
  • Keep men's and women's spa areas clean, orderly and properly stocked throughout the shift.
  • Assist in training newer staff on front desk procedures to ensure efficient performance and consistency in service standards.
  • Carry out deep cleaning tasks and special projects as assigned.

Requirements
  • Exceptional interpersonal and communication skills with the ability to create a warm, welcoming, and professional first impression for all guests.
  • Strong organizational and time management skills with the ability to man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ced, guest-facing environment.
  • High attention to detail to ensure accuracy in scheduling, billing, and guest preferences.
  • Ability to remain calm, composed, and solution-oriented when handling guest requests or concerns.
  • Proficiency with scheduling systems, point-of-sale systems, and general computer applications such as Microsoft Office or Google Suite.
  • Strong teamwork and collaboration skills with the ability to communicate effectively with therapists, spa leadership, and other hotel departments.
  • Basic understanding of spa services, treatments, and retail products with the ability to confidently guide guest selections.
  • Professional presentation and demeanor aligned with a luxury hospitality environment.
  • High school diploma or equivalent experience or training required.
  • Minimum of one year of guest-facing experience in hospitality, spa, wellness, or a related service environment preferred.
  • Experience with spa booking software or property management systems preferred.
  • Luxury hotel or resort experience preferred but not required.
  • Previous experience handling cash, payments, and guest transactions preferred.
  • Flexible availability including evenings, weekends, and holidays based on business needs.
